    The Courage to SoTL

    Using Parker Palmer’s The Courage to Teach, and in particular the notion of the undivided life, to guide reflections through the process of collaborative autoethnography, we reflect on our lived experiences with the Scholarship of Teaching and Learning (SoTL). The central question being: How does Palmer’s idea of the undivided life enable SoTL scholars to explore notions of identity and integrity that are intertwined with our academic practice? Ultimately, we found that Palmer’s insights provoked us to think deeply about our identities, and while perhaps we did not always see ourselves on the paths he illuminates, his work, and our collaborative ethnographic process, helped us to illuminate our own paths. More specifically, we share five themes arising from our collaborative autoethnography related to the importance of context and positionality, defining a SoTL scholar, the power to diminish, the importance of relationships and community, and collaborative autoethnography as method and process. Our stories highlight the need for us to see our community as complex, messy, and deeply human, and we remind readers of the need to think about the ethics of all methods and the power in our everyday practice to include or exclude

    Neuroscience Informed Prolonged Exposure Practice: Increasing Efficiency and Efficacy Through Mechanisms

    Prolonged exposure (PE) is an empirically supported efficacious treatment for posttraumatic stress disorder (PTSD). In this focused review, we briefly review the neurobiological networks in PTSD relevant to PE, discuss the theoretical basis of PE, review the neurobiological mechanisms underlying the effectiveness of PE and identify the enhancements that can be applied to increase treatment response and retention. Based on the reviewed studies, it is clear that PTSD results in disrupted network of interconnected regions, and PE has been shown to increase the connectivity within and between these regions. Successful extinction recall in PE is related to increased functional coherence between the ventromedial prefrontal cortex (vmPFC), amygdala and the hippocampus. Increased connectivity within the dorsolateral PFC (dlPFC) following PE is associated with more effective downregulation of emotional responses in stressful situations. Pre-existing neural connectivity also in some cases predicts response to exposure treatment. We consider various enhancements that have been used with PE, including serotonin reuptake inhibitors (SSRIs), D-cycloserine (DCS), allopregnanolone (ALLO) and propranolol, repetitive transcranial magnetic stimulation (rTMS), oxytocin and MDMA. Given that neural connectivity appears to be crucial in mechanisms of action of PE, rTMS is a logical target for further research as an enhancement of PE. Additionally, exploring the effectiveness and mechanisms of action of oxytocin and MDMA in conjunction with PE may lead to improvement in treatment engagement and retention

    Thiyl-Radical Reactions in Carbohydrate Chemistry: From Thiosugars to Glycoconjugate Synthesis

    Thiyl-radical mediated reactions have been extensively investigated for the preparation of carbohydrate derivatives. Due to the mild reaction conditions, high yields and tolerance to a wide range of functional groups, these reactions are ideally suited to the preparation of bioconjugates including glycopeptides and glycoproteins. This microreview covers the various synthetic strategies that have been employed for the preparation of thiosugars, glycoconjugates and glycodendrimers, employing the carbohydrate unit as both the carrier of the thiyl radical and also as the acceptor. Both the inter- and intramolecular thiol-ene and -yne processes are presented and discussed. Future perspective and directions for this methodology in glycoscience are also examined

    Developing a very low vision orientation and mobility test battery (O&M-VLV)

    Purpose This study aimed to determine the feasibility of an assessment of vision-related orientation and mobility (O&amp;M) tasks in persons with severe vision loss. These tasks may be used for future low vision rehabilitation clinical assessments or as outcome measures in vision restoration trials. Methods Forty legally blind persons (mean visual acuity logMAR 2.3, or hand movements) with advanced retinitis pigmentosa participated in the Orientation &amp; Mobility—Very Low Vision (O&amp;M-VLV) subtests from the Low Vision Assessment of Daily Activities (LoVADA) protocol. Four categories of tasks were evaluated: route travel in three indoor hospital environments, a room orientation task (the “cafe”), a visual exploration task (the “gallery”), and a modified version of the Timed Up and Go (TUG) test, which assesses re-orientation and route travel. Spatial cognition was assessed using the Stuart Tactile Maps test. Visual acuity and visual fields were measured. Results A generalized linear regression model showed that a number of measures in the O&amp;M-VLV tasks were related to residual visual function. The percentage of preferred walking speed without an aid on three travel routes was associated with visual field (p < 0.01 for all routes) whereas the number of contacts with obstacles during route travel was associated with acuity (p = 0.001). TUG-LV task time was associated with acuity (p = 0.003), as was the cafe time and distance traveled (p = 0.006 and p < 0.001, respectively). The gallery score was the only measure that was significantly associated with both residual acuity and fields (p < 0.001 and p = 0.001, respectively). Conclusions The O&amp;M-VLV was designed to capture key elements of O&amp;M performance in persons with severe vision loss, which is a population not often studied previously. Performance on these tasks was associated with both binocular visual acuity and visual field. This new protocol includes assessments of orientation, which may be of benefit in vision restoration clinical trials
